Output 7530fb64a16a60160728242329cd249faa46dfcf25fdfdf0190428bc3f426fda:1

value
2654616
script pubkey
OP_0 OP_PUSHBYTES_20 d904c27a0fe09962ebf187c22d5e0e86dc389220
address
bc1qmyzvy7s0uzvk96l3slpz6hswsmwr3y3qre5gev
transaction
7530fb64a16a60160728242329cd249faa46dfcf25fdfdf0190428bc3f426fda